When you first put a piece of food in your mouth, it is first grinded by your teeth, then saliva comes in to help you break down your food, the more you chew the more digestive enzymes occur, these enzymes are extremely important, they help your body take in nutrients from what you eat. This is why it's important to chew your food thoroughly before you swallow,

The action that the nurse can take to promote venous distention in the patient include:
- Apply a warm pack to the arm for several minutes
- Rub or stroke the patient's arm.
